Is Abdominal Pain And Flipped Over Bowel Sign Of Crohn S Disease?

Hi - 10 days ago I woke to an abdominal pain mainly centered on my left side which literally brought me to my knees. I knew this couldn t be appendicitis because mine had been removed years ago plus the location]was wrong. In the hospital ER a CAT scan was performed which confirmed the attending physician s initial suspicion plus a surgeon had already been called in. It ended up that the right side of my bowels had totally flipped over to the left side, there were pockets of septis (?) & a large mass of impacted dry fecal matter needed removal. Eight inches of my bowels were removed & reconnected but at least I don t have a colostomy. I came home from hospital today with 23 staples which needed to stay a few extra days because I needed a dose of steroids due to major breathing issues after the anesthetic. My questions are: How common is something like this? Over the years I would have MAJOR pain which could bring me to the ER yet nothing would be discovered - even once after exploratory surgery. Could this have been my bowels having flipped out of place before but then flipping back in place again? All those years of agonizing pain leading up to the straw that broke the camel s back ! & can something like this happen again? The surgeon said I came this close to things rupturing whatever that may mean. Oh yeah, I forgot to mention that 3 years ago my sister went through practically the same thing & now has been diagnosed with crohn s disease. She now calls me a copycat - the nerve :) Is this unusual?

General & Family Physician 's  Response
hello n welcome. I read your history carefully. firstly u need to specify the flipped bowel description from ur surgeon ie whether ur bowel was obstructed strangulated or ischemic
2ndly crohn s disease is part of inflammatory bowel disease which initially presents with episodes of FEVER WEIGHT LOSS BLOODY DIARRHEA AND ABDOMINAL PAIN. CROHNS SIGNS INCLUDE A PALPABLE ABDOMINAL MASS AND HAS ORAL N PERIANAL INVOLVEMENT, ALSO CAUSES FISTULA N STRICTURE FORMATION.
DIAGNOSTIC TESTS FOR CROHNS IS ENDOSCOPY BOTH UPPER N LOWER GI TO FIND SKIP LESIONS. AND BARIUM STUDIES. THE DIAGNOSIS CAN BE AIDED VIA PERFORMING SEROLOGICAL ASCA ANTIBODIES IE ANTI SACCHAROMYCES CEREVISCIAE ANTIBODIES.
